导读 在前端开发中,`window.location.href` 是一个非常实用的工具,用于重定向页面或传递参数。当我们需要在不同页面间共享数据时,可以通过它...
在前端开发中,`window.location.href` 是一个非常实用的工具,用于重定向页面或传递参数。当我们需要在不同页面间共享数据时,可以通过它轻松实现参数的传递。例如,当你想从当前页面跳转到另一个页面并附带一些信息时,可以使用 `window.location.href = 'targetPage.html?param1=value1¶m2=value2';` 这种方式来完成。😉
这种方式简单高效,但需要注意的是,URL 的长度有限制,并且传递敏感信息时应避免直接暴露。此外,在接收页面中,我们需要通过 `URLSearchParams` 或其他方法解析这些参数。比如,`const params = new URLSearchParams(window.location.search);` 能帮助我们获取特定的参数值。😎
合理利用 `window.location.href` 可以简化许多复杂的交互逻辑,提升用户体验。不过,记得始终关注安全性问题,确保传递的数据不会被滥用。🌟
版权声明:本文由用户上传,如有侵权请联系删除!